Transaction 29c66697c04aec7923304a78acec2b5458fda0b193db9a8295661e2a916f4335
1 Input
1 Output
-
29c66697c04aec7923304a78acec2b5458fda0b193db9a8295661e2a916f4335:0
- value
- 309978
- script pubkey
- OP_0 OP_PUSHBYTES_32 7f510c69c440609ae993edb1dda278c90775e3dd2aefd45e8f66806606c58b4d
- address
- bc1q0agsc6wygpsf46vnakcamgnceyrhtc7a9thagh50v6qxvpk93dxsf6x7g3